A payment processor is manages the technical aspects of payment transactions, guaranteeing that data is securely transmitted between the merchant's bank (acquirer) and the customer's bank (issuer). For travel, having a dependable payment processor is crucial for facilitating smooth and secure transactions, whether customers are making online bookings or paying in person.
Payment processors are the backbone of the travel payments ecosystem, enabling travel companies to accept a wide variety of payment methods, including credit cards, digital wallets, and bank transfers. Processors handle authorisation, settlement, and clearing of transactions, ensuring that payments are completed securely and efficiently.
Travel companies must choose processors that can handle international transactions, support multiple currencies, and provide robust security features to protect against fraud. The cost of processing fees is also a key consideration for businesses in the high-transaction-volume travel industry.
